Transaction 074ce5d7f2f301b02eb6023952ea8c2e3279d775583df2d8b58c8794ef6ebecf

1 Input
2 Outputs
  • 074ce5d7f2f301b02eb6023952ea8c2e3279d775583df2d8b58c8794ef6ebecf:0
  • value  3370575068
    address  1BDBJY2JEs8TY8dz3Gvah74zmNNJ9TMNX3
  • 074ce5d7f2f301b02eb6023952ea8c2e3279d775583df2d8b58c8794ef6ebecf:1
  • value  1385414932
    address  1Jhvw6FQ7PU4jUuybhQik4UxXVuPrkRbUr